CVS Deal...$100 worth of stuff for $20...and all this was FREE!

Last night I stayed up late and did my homework to learn more about how to really take advantage of CVS' Extra Care Bucks (ECB) program. I found out that each month there is a separate flyer listing deals, then there is an additional sales flyer each week. When you "stack" coupons on top of these great deals, you come out with some really great bargains. Check out BeCentsAble for more info on how their program works.

So today after work I made my 'cheat sheet' list of what to buy and which coupons to use before heading on over to CVS. I divided my purchases into two different transactions to take advantage of the ECBs. Even though I realized I didn't separate the transactions out perfectly (I could have saved $5 more), I still ended up with $100 worth of merchandise for less than $20!!

Check it out...everything in the picture was FREE. It was a combination of sales, using ECBs, and coupons together that sealed the deal. Wow, I get excited about this stuff, but this means less money on "essentials" and more money on DEBT!
